David’s Last Words
23 Now these are the last words of David.
Thus says David the son of Jesse;
Thus says (A)the man raised up on high,
(B)The anointed of the God of Jacob,
And the sweet psalmist of Israel:
2 “The(C) Spirit of the Lord spoke by me,
And His word was on my tongue.

Ezekiel 2:1-4
New King James Version
Ezekiel Called to Be a Prophet
2 And He said to me, “Son of man, (A)stand on your feet, and I will speak to you.” 2 Then (B)the Spirit entered me when He spoke to me, and set me on my feet; and I heard Him who spoke to me. 3 And He said to me: “Son of man, I am sending you to the children of Israel, to a rebellious nation that has (C)rebelled against Me; (D)they and their fathers have transgressed against Me to this very day. 4 (E)For they are [a]impudent and stubborn children. I am sending you to them, and you shall say to them, ‘Thus says the Lord God.’
Read full chapterFootnotes
- Ezekiel 2:4 Lit. stiff-faced and hard-hearted sons
Ezekiel 2:1-4
New International Version
Ezekiel’s Call to Be a Prophet
2 He said to me, “Son of man,[a](A) stand(B) up on your feet and I will speak to you.(C)” 2 As he spoke, the Spirit came into me and raised me(D) to my feet, and I heard him speaking to me.
3 He said: “Son of man, I am sending you to the Israelites, to a rebellious nation that has rebelled against me; they and their ancestors have been in revolt against me to this very day.(E) 4 The people to whom I am sending you are obstinate and stubborn.(F) Say to them, ‘This is what the Sovereign Lord says.’(G)
Footnotes
- Ezekiel 2:1 The Hebrew phrase ben adam means human being. The phrase son of man is retained as a form of address here and throughout Ezekiel because of its possible association with “Son of Man” in the New Testament.
